What is auto insurance with SR22 ?

SR22 insurance, generally described as SR-22, is an auto liability insurance record needed by a lot of state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) offices for certain motorists. This insurance functions as proof that a car driver has actually the minimum needed liability insurance coverage from the state. The value of it is that it permits the car driver to keep or renew driving privileges after specific traffic-related offenses. It is very important to comprehend that it is not a sort of auto insurance, however a verification that the insurance company vouches for the motorist, promising to cover any future cases.

The need for an SR-22 form represents that the person has had a gap in protection or has been associated with an accident without enough insurance to cover damages. The insurance company releases the SR-22 forms to the state DMV to confirm the vehicle driver's financial responsibility, indicating they are currently appropriately guaranteed. The SR-22 is a time-bound demand, which means it is not an irreversible mark on a car driver's record. This process guarantees that the driver lugs at the very least the minimum liability insurance the states mandate. Just how much does SR-22 insurance price?

The fee of SR-22 insurance can vary commonly based on different aspects such as an individual's driving record, the factor for the SR-22 requirement, and the state where the vehicle driver lives. The immediate monetary influence can be found in the type of a filing fee, which usually varies from $15 to $25. Nevertheless, the much more substantial fee comes from the expected increase in auto insurance rate. The statement of a plan gap bring about a demand for SR-22 attracts the depiction of the car driver as high threat in the eyes of auto insurance suppliers. A high-risk label can associate dramatically to the hike in month-to-month prices.

Further making complex the price computation is the sort of protection required. While a non-owner car insurance policy may cost less than an owner's plan, the specific demand for a raised quantity of insurance coverage can escalate costs. Most states mandate a minimal quantity of liability insurance coverage, consisting of both bodily injury and property damage liability, of which a fair amount should be mirrored in the insurance policy bundled with the SR-22 type. To add fuel to the fire, in some states like Florida and Virginia, FR-44 insurance, which needs even greater liability insurance coverage, might be a required. In a nutshell, while the actual fee of submitting an SR-22 form is reasonably low, the indirect costs arising from its effect on auto insurance rates and liability insurance requirements can produce an opening in your pocket.

What's the big difference between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both types of insurance accreditations made use of by states to validate a car driver's financial responsibility and guarantee they meet the respective state's minimum auto insurance requirements. The considerable difference between these certificates mostly depends on the objective they offer and the liability limits. With an SR-22, often required for people with DUIs or significant driving offenses, the liability requirements resemble those of an ordinary vehicle insurance policy. This accreditation can be acquired by including it to a current policy or by safeguarding a non-owner policy if the person does not own a vehicle.

FR-44, on the other hand, specifies to 2 states-- Virginia and Florida, and comes with higher liability limits, especially for bodily injury liability. It's usually mandated for individuals really needing a hardship license after a substantial driving offense, such as a DUI where injury or considerable property damages occurred. Furthermore, FR-44 filing period is normally longer and the average fee greater than that of SR-22, due to the increased coverage it requires. What occurs if an SR-22 insurance policy is canceled?

The cancellation of an SR-22 insurance policy can commonly cause major effects. When an insurance policy holder's SR-22 insurance is terminated - whether due to non-payment, plan gap, or any other factor - insurance service providers have a duty to alert the proper state authorities about this modification. This is accomplished by filing an SR-26 kind, which successfully signifies the end of the insurance holder's SR-22 insurance protection.

When the proper state authorities have actually been informed of the termination of SR-22 insurance, the impacted motorist's permit can potentially be put on hold once again. This results from the authorities' requirement to make certain that the vehicle drivers are constantly gu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ement.
